Scott Shannon's music is innovative and adventurous. Scott Shannon has been composing, arranging, and performing for the past three decades. He has appeared at a variety of venues in New York, Miami, Los Angeles, San Francisco, and throughout the south. After years of 'big city' life he has retreated to the mountains of North Carolina where he composes and records in his home studio. NPCB: Ngee Ann Polytechnic Concert Band Ngee Ann Polytechnic Concert Band was established in 1983, under the baton of our resident conductor, Mr Yeo Poong Poh. The idea of forming a band was conceived by our 4th principal, Mr. Chen Hung, a noted music lover. The band started off with 20 members and has since developed into an established band of 50 members.
